Dried blood spot (DBS) methodology offers significant advantages over venipuncture in studies of vulnerable populations or large-scale studies, including reduced participant burden and higher response rates. Uncertainty about the validity of cardiovascular disease (CVD) risk biomarkers remains a barrier to wide-scale use. We determined the validity of DBS-derived biomarkers of CVD risk versus gold-standard assessments, and study-specific, serum-equivalency values for clinical relevance of DBS-derived values. Concurrent venipuncture serum and DBS samples (n = 150 adults) were assayed in Clinical Laboratory Improvement Amendments-certified and DBS laboratories, respectively. Time controls of DBS standard samples were assayed single-blind along with test samples. Linear regression analyses evaluated DBS-to-serum equivalency values; agreement and bias were assessed via Bland-Altman plots. Linear regressions of venipuncture values on DBS-to-serum equivalencies provided R(2) values for total cholesterol, high-density lipoprotein cholesterol (HDL-C), and C-reactive protein (CRP) of 0.484, 0.118, and 0.666, respectively. Bland-Altman plots revealed minimal systematic bias between DBS-to-serum and venipuncture values; precision worsened at higher mean values of CRP. Time controls revealed little degradation or change in analyte values for HDL-C and CRP over 30 weeks. We concluded that DBS-assessed biomarkers represent a valid alternative to venipuncture assessments. Large studies using DBS should include study-specific serum-equivalency determinations to optimize individual-level sensitivity, the viability of detecting intervention effects, and generalizability in community-level primary prevention interventions.

OBJECTIVES: The aim of this study was to investigate the longitudinal effect of work-related stress, sleep deficiency, and physical activity on 10-year cardiometabolic risk among an all-female worker population. METHODS: Data on patient care workers (n=99) was collected 2 years apart. Baseline measures included: job stress, physical activity, night work, and sleep deficiency. Biomarkers and objective measurements were used to estimate 10-year cardiometabolic risk at follow-up. Significant associations (P<0.05) from baseline analyses were used to build a multivariable linear regression model. RESULTS: The participants were mostly white nurses with a mean age of 41 years. Adjusted linear regression showed that having sleep maintenance problems, a different occupation than nurse, and/or not exercising at recommended levels at baseline increased the 10-year cardiometabolic risk at follow-up. CONCLUSIONS: In female workers prone to work-related stress and sleep deficiency, maintaining sleep and exercise patterns had a strong impact on modifiable 10-year cardiometabolic risk.

Biomarkers are directly-measured biological indicators of disease, health, exposures, or other biological information. In population and social sciences, biomarkers need to be easy to obtain, transport, and analyze. Dried Blood Spots meet this need, and can be collected in the field with high response rates. These elements are particularly important in longitudinal study designs including interventions where attrition is critical to avoid, and high response rates improve the interpretation of results. Dried Blood Spot sample collection is simple, quick, relatively painless, less invasive then venipuncture, and requires minimal field storage requirements (i.e. samples do not need to be immediately frozen and can be stored for a long period of time in a stable freezer environment before assay). The samples can be analyzed for a variety of different analytes, including cholesterol, C-reactive protein, glycosylated hemoglobin, numerous cytokines, and other analytes, as well as provide genetic material. DBS collection is depicted as employed in several recent studies.

OBJECTIVE: Health care workers are at high risk of developing musculoskeletal symptoms and pain. This study tested the hypothesis that sleep deficiency is associated with pain, functional limitations, and physical limitations that interfere with work. METHODS: Hospital patient care workers completed a survey (79% response rate) including measures of health, sociodemographic, and workplace factors. Associations of sleep deficiency with pain, work interference due to this pain, and functional limitations were determined. RESULTS: Of 1572 respondents (90% women; mean age, 41 years), 57% reported sleep deficiency, 73% pain in last 3 months, 33% work interference, and 18% functional limitation. Sleep deficiency was associated with higher rates of pain, work interference, and functional limitation controlling for socioeconomic, individual, and workplace characteristics. CONCLUSIONS: Sleep deficiency is significantly associated with pain, functional limitation, and workplace interference, suggesting modifiable outcomes for workplace health and safety interventions.

Epidemiological studies link short sleep duration and circadian disruption with higher risk of metabolic syndrome and diabetes. We tested the hypotheses that prolonged sleep restriction with concurrent circadian disruption, as can occur in people performing shift work, impairs glucose regulation and metabolism. Healthy adults spent >5 weeks under controlled laboratory conditions in which they experienced an initial baseline segment of optimal sleep, 3 weeks of sleep restriction (5.6 hours of sleep per 24 hours) combined with circadian disruption (recurring 28-hour "days"), followed by 9 days of recovery sleep with circadian re-entrainment. Exposure to prolonged sleep restriction with concurrent circadian disruption, with measurements taken at the same circadian phase, decreased the participants' resting metabolic rate and increased plasma glucose concentrations after a meal, an effect resulting from inadequate pancreatic insulin secretion. These parameters normalized during the 9 days of recovery sleep and stable circadian re-entrainment. Thus, in humans, prolonged sleep restriction with concurrent circadian disruption alters metabolism and could increase the risk of obesity and diabetes.

The rumen, the foregut of herbivorous ruminant animals such as cattle, functions as a bioreactor to process complex plant material. Among the numerous and diverse microbes involved in ruminal digestion are the ruminal protozoans, which are single-celled, ciliated eukaryotic organisms. An activity-based screen was executed to identify genes encoding fibrolytic enzymes present in the metatranscriptome of a bovine ruminal protozoan-enriched cDNA expression library. Of the four novel genes identified, two were characterized in biochemical assays. Our results provide evidence for the effective use of functional metagenomics to retrieve novel enzymes from microbial populations that cannot be maintained in axenic cultures.

Two masked priming experiments examined behavioural and event-related potential responses to simplex target words (e.g., flex) preceded by briefly presented, masked, derived word primes (flexible-flex), complex nonword primes formed by an illegal combination of the target word and a real suffix (flexify-flex), and simplex nonword primes formed by adding a nonsuffix word ending to the target (flexint-flex). Subjects performed a lexical decision task. Behavioural results showed that all prime types significantly facilitated target recognition. Priming effects were reflected in the electrophysiological data by reduced N250 and N400 amplitudes, and these priming effects were statistically equivalent for the three types of prime. The strong priming effects found with simplex primes in the present study, compared with prior research, are thought to be due to the combination of targets always being completely embedded in prime stimuli plus the reduced lexical inhibition that arises with nonword primes. In line with prior behavioural research, however, there was evidence for differential priming effects as a function of prime type in the N400 ERP component in Experiment 2, with greater priming effects for derived and pseudocomplex primes relative to simplex primes at lateral posterior electrode sites.

Aging is associated with insulin resistance, often attributable to obesity and inactivity. Recent evidence suggests that skeletal muscle insulin resistance in aging is associated with mitochondrial alterations. Whether this is true of the senescent myocardium is unknown. Twelve young (Y, 4 years old) and 12 old (O, 11 years old) dogs, matched for body mass, were instrumented with left-ventricular pressure gauges, aortic and coronary sinus catheters, and flow probes on left circumflex artery. Before surgery, all dogs participated in a 6-wk exercise program. Dogs underwent measurements of hemodynamics and plasma substrates before and during a 2-h hyperinsulinemic-euglycemic clamp to measure whole body and myocardial glucose and nonesterified fatty acid uptake. Following the protocol, myocardial and skeletal samples were obtained to measure components of the insulin-signaling cascade and mitochondrial structure. There was no difference in plasma glucose (Y, 90 +/- 4 mg/dl; O, 87 +/- 4 mg/dl), but old dogs had higher (P < 0.02) nonesterified fatty acids (Y, 384 +/- 48 micromol/l; O, 952 +/- 97 micromol/l) and plasma insulin (Y, 39 +/- 11 pmol/l; O, 108 +/- 18 pmol/l). Old dogs had impaired total body glucose disposition (Y, 11.5 +/- 1 mg x kg(-1) x min(-1); O, 8.0 +/- 0.5 mg x kg(-1) x min(-1); P < 0.05) and insulin-stimulated myocardial glucose uptake (Y, 3.5 +/- 0.3 mg x min(-1) x g(-1); O, 1.8 +/- 0.3 mg x min(-1) x g(-1); P < 0.05). The impaired insulin action was associated with altered insulin signaling and glucose transporter (GLUT4) translocation. There were myocardial mitochondrial structural changes observed in association with decreased expression of uncoupling protein-3. Aging is associated with both whole body and myocardial insulin resistance, independent of obesity and inactivity, but involving altered mitochondrial structure and impaired cellular insulin action.

Limited nutritional information exists on diets of free-ranging orangutans, Pongo abelii and P. pygmaeus. Although they are classified as frugivores, the chemical composition of their diet and their gastrointestinal anatomy suggest that they rely on fiber fermentation for a substantial portion of energy. However, the extent to which they can ferment fiber is not known. Continuous culture systems, inoculated with orangutan fecal bacteria, were established to determine the fiber-digesting capacity of orangutan hindgut microflora. The cultures received one of four treatments: soybean hulls, ground corncobs, corn starch, or no food. Neither dry matter nor neutral detergent fiber digestibilities differed significantly among treatments. However, neutral detergent fiber digestibilities were high for both the soybean hull (88.4%) and ground corncob (86.1%) treatments, indicating that the microflora had a strong fibrolytic capability. To determine whether the same fiber-degrading capacity occurred in vivo, two adult orangutans and one juvenile were fed four gel-matrix diets containing soybean hulls, ground corncobs, or ground primate biscuits. Neutral detergent fiber concentrations (dry matter basis) of the gel matrices were 52.9% with soybean hulls, 46.8% and 63.7% with ground corncobs, and 31.3% with ground primate biscuits. A fifth diet consisted of primate biscuits with 27.3% neutral detergent fiber (dry matter basis) and was considered the baseline diet. Neutral detergent fiber digestibility (74.5%) was greatest (P < 0.05) for the soybean hull gel diet and least (57.5% and 45.0%, respectively; P < 0.05) for the 63.7% neutral detergent fiber (dry matter basis) corncob gel diet and the baseline primate biscuit diet. Total volatile fatty acid concentrations in orangutan feces were not significantly different among diets; however, molar proportions of acetic, propionic, and butyric acid differed (P < 0.05) among diets. The results from both studies indicated that orangutans are capable of extensive fiber fermentation.

Black lemurs, Eulemur macaco, are classified as generalist feeders, consuming a proportion of fruits and leaves that varies with seasonal availability. It is hypothesized that black lemurs are capable of using neutral detergent fiber (NDF) as a source of energy through fiber fermentation in the cecum and large intestine. In captivity, they are typically fed a diet of commercially available primate biscuits and readily available produce, both of which are limited in NDE Digestibility trials were conducted on 14 black lemurs; 12 were housed in groups (four, three, three, and two) and 2 were individually housed. The lemurs were fed four manufactured feeds differing in fiber form and content. A commercially available primate biscuit, containing approximately 27% NDF, served as the control diet. The second diet contained the same primate biscuits, which were ground and then incorporated into a fiber-based gel matrix. The third and fourth diets were formulated using soybean hulls or ground corncobs as the fiber source, resulting in 53% and 47% NDF, respectively. Produce was added to the diet at 36% (dry matter basis). Dry matter digestibility differed significantly among all diets. Neutral detergent fiber digestibility was highest for the ground biscuit in gel and lowest for the two high-fiber gel diets, with biscuit digestibility values falling between the two extremes. The high-fiber gel diets were successful in increasing the NDF concentrations of the primate diets; however, black lemurs were capable of only limited fiber digestion.
